Ham and Split Pea Soup

prep time:
20 min
total time:
1 hr and 20 minutes
Makes 8 servings
KatieKatie Losik

ingredients

  • 1 pound dried split peas
  • 3 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 1 cup finely chopped yellow onions
  • 1/2 cup finely chopped celery
  • 1/2 cup finely chopped carrots
  • 2 teaspoons minced garlic
  • 1 pound ham, chopped
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 3/4 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
  • 8 cups water
  • 1 bay leaf
  • 2 teaspoons fresh thyme

directions

  • 1

    Place the peas in a large pot or bowl, cover with water by 2 inches and soak 8 hours or overnight. Drain the peas and set aside.

  • 2

    In a large pot, melt the butter over medium-high heat. Add the onions and cook, stirring, for 2 minutes. Add the celery and carrots and cook, stirring, until just soft, about 3 minutes. Add the garlic and cook, stirring, for 30 seconds.

  • 3

    Add the ham and cook, stirring, until beginning to brown. Add the drained peas, salt, pepper, and cook, stirring for 2 minutes. Add 8 cups of water, the bay leaf and thyme, and cook, stirring occasionally, until the peas are tender, about 1 hour. (Add more water as needed, if the soup becomes too thick or dry.)

  • 4

    Remove the bay leaf and discard. Adjust the seasoning, to taste, and serve.
